Model ChemLab App Introduction
Model ChemLab is an exceptional chemical laboratory simulation software designed specifically for the Windows platform. It offers a unique and immersive learning experience for chemical students, allowing them to explore and practice various laboratory procedures and experiments in a virtual environment.
The Interactive Simulation
The software incorporates an interactive simulation that closely mimics the real laboratory experience. Users can interact with animated equipment such as beakers, Erlenmeyer and Florence flasks, test tubes, graduated cylinders, burets, eye droppers, pipets, watch glasses, filtering flasks with Buchner funnels, Bunsen burners, hot plates / Magnetic stirrers, stirring rods, evaporation dishes, calorimeters, conductivity meters, and more. The simulation enables users to step through the actual lab procedures, providing a hands-on learning approach that enhances understanding and practical skills.
The Lab Notebook Workspace
In addition to the interactive simulation, Model ChemLab features a lab notebook workspace with separate areas for theory, procedures, and student observations. This workspace allows students to document their experiments, record their findings, and analyze the data, fostering a systematic and organized approach to learning.
Commonly Used Equipment and Procedures
The software includes a wide range of commonly used lab equipment and procedures. From titration and decanting / pouring to heating and hot / cold water baths, as well as measurements of temperature, weight, pH, conductivity, voltage, and volume, Model ChemLab covers all the essential aspects of a chemical laboratory. This comprehensive coverage ensures that students are well-prepared to handle real-world laboratory situations.
